What details make the lyrics land in an electronic track?

Specificity is the whole game. The more concrete details you give - a city, a year, a defining moment, a running joke - the more the lyrics feel authored rather than generated. With electronic music, the lyric structure tends toward punchy, rhythmic lines that pair with the beat. Short, vivid phrases work better than long, descriptive ones.

Good starting points: the birthday person's nickname, the year they did something memorable, a place the two of you share, or a phrase only they would recognize. These slot naturally into verse and chorus structure without sounding forced. The AI knows how to handle meter and syllable count, so you do not need to write in rhyme - just give the raw material and let it work.

Voice choice also shapes the feel. A clear, bright female lead over a synth pad reads as anthemic and warm. A punchy male vocal over a harder kick drum reads as confident and fun. Neither is better in the abstract - both depend on the person you are gifting.

How does an electronic birthday song compare to other music genres for this occasion?

Pop is the safe, universally accessible choice. Acoustic is the intimate, heartfelt choice. Electronic is the high-energy, celebration-forward choice. If the person you are gifting uses music to get pumped up, to mark a moment, or to set a party atmosphere, electronic is the genre that does that job best. For someone who listens to folk at home, electronic would be a mismatch. For someone who sends you festival lineups and playlist drops, it is exactly right.
